Hood Connector Side Entry M25 HB16 IP65 (LAPP 19082000) - Equivalent & Substitute Parts

Part Overview

The LAPP 19082000 is an active heavy-duty hood connector designed for side entry applications with M25 thread size and HB16 form factor. This connector provides IP65 ingress protection (dust tight, water resistant) and operates across a temperature range of -40°C to 100°C. The connector features aluminum alloy housing with powder coating and dual locking clips positioned on the base bottom for secure installation.

Substitute parts are identified to address inventory availability, extended temperature requirements, or supply chain continuity while maintaining functional and mechanical compatibility.

Substitute Part Grouping Explanation

Substitution eligibility is determined by strict alignment with the following critical parameters:

Critical Parameters (Must Match):

  • Connector Type: Hood
  • Style: Side Entry
  • Thread Size: M25
  • Ingress Protection Rating: IP65 (Dust Tight, Water Resistant)
  • Lock Location: Locking Clip (2) on Base Bottom

Important Parameters (Must Be Compatible):

  • Housing Material: Aluminum or Aluminum Alloy
  • Housing Finish: Powder Coated
  • Operating Temperature Range: Must meet or exceed -40°C minimum and 100°C maximum

The HARTING 19300161521 (Han® B series) qualifies as a substitute because it satisfies all critical parameters and maintains material and finish compatibility. The substitute operates at an extended upper temperature limit (-40°C to 125°C), providing additional thermal margin.

Engineering Selection Recommendations

LAPP 19082000 (Primary Selection):

  • Use when EPIC® HB series integration is required
  • Suitable for applications within -40°C to 100°C operating range
  • Active product status ensures continued availability and support

HARTING 19300161521 (Substitute Selection):

  • Use when Han® B series compatibility is acceptable
  • Provides extended upper temperature capability (-40°C to 125°C)
  • RoHS3 compliance and REACH unaffected status documented
  • MSL rating of 1 (Unlimited) indicates no moisture sensitivity constraints
  • Active product status ensures continued availability and support
  • Dimensional variations (length +0.008", height +0.059") fall within standard mechanical tolerances for connector applications

Both parts maintain identical critical functional parameters: M25 thread, IP65 ingress protection, side entry configuration, and dual locking clip base mounting. Selection between these parts should be based on series preference, temperature margin requirements, and supply availability.

Frequently Asked Questions (FAQ)

Q: Can HARTING 19300161521 directly replace LAPP 19082000 in existing installations?

A: Yes, provided the application environment and mounting interface accommodate the dimensional variations. The substitute maintains identical thread size (M25), locking mechanism (dual clips on base bottom), and ingress protection rating (IP65). Length and height differences are within standard mechanical tolerances for heavy-duty connector applications.

Q: What is the significance of the different size designations (HB16 vs. 16B)?

A: HB16 and 16B represent equivalent form factors within their respective manufacturer series (EPIC® HB and Han® B). Both designations indicate the same functional connector size class and are interchangeable for the specified application parameters.

Q: Does the extended temperature range of the HARTING substitute affect compatibility?

A: No. The HARTING 19300161521 operates from -40°C to 125°C, which encompasses the LAPP 19082000 range of -40°C to 100°C. Extended upper temperature capability provides additional thermal margin without compromising lower temperature performance.

Q: Are there differences in housing material between these parts?

A: The LAPP uses aluminum alloy, while the HARTING uses die-cast aluminum. Both materials provide equivalent corrosion resistance and mechanical strength when powder coated. Die-cast aluminum offers consistent dimensional accuracy and is standard in heavy-duty connector manufacturing.
